Bayfield Ventures Corp. (TSX-V: BYV) is exploring for gold and silver in the Rainy River district of northwestern Ontario.
Bayfield owns 100% of the mineral rights to its flagship "Burns" Block gold-silver project located in the Richardson Township, Rainy River District of northwestern Ontario. The Burns Block is located adjacent to the east of New Gold's (TSX: NGD) multi-million ounce Rainy River gold-silver deposit and adjacent to the west of New Gold's expanding Intrepid gold-silver zone.
Drilling to date on the Western Zone of the Burns Block demonstrates that the main ODM17 gold-silver deposit extends from New Gold's ground adjacent to the west onto Bayfield's Burns Block. Notable drill results from Bayfield's ongoing 100,000 metre drill program include 60.05 grams per tonne gold and 362.96 grams per tonne silver over 11.2 metres in hole RR11-71, as well as 35.93 grams per tonne gold and 359.65 grams per tonne silver over 10.0 metres in hole RR10-18 located approximately 350 metres to the south with numerous high grade holes drilled in between.
The Company is currently focused on drilling the high grade gold-silver East Burns - Intrepid Zone discovered on the eastern side of the Burns Block. Bayfield continues to drill test the up and down-plunge extension of this expanding mineralized zone which is projected to be the down-dip portion of New Gold's newly discovered Intrepid Zone. Notable early results from the zone include 6.60 grams per tonne gold and 34.20 grams per tonne silver over 25.50 metres including 11.06 grams per tonne gold and 57.05 grams per tonne silver over 15.00 metres in wedge hole RR12-34W1, 5.45 grams per tonne gold and 20.63 grams per tonne silver over 19.60 metres in hole RR12-30, and 12.19 grams per tonne gold and 30.05 grams per tonne silver over 11.90 metres in hole RR 13-07.

A Memorandum of Association (MOA) is a legal document that outlines the fundamental principles and objectives upon which a company operates. It serves as the company's charter or constitution and defines the scope of its activities. Here's a detailed note on the MOA:
Contents of Memorandum of Association:
Name Clause: This clause states the name of the company, which should end with words like "Limited" or "Ltd." for a public limited company and "Private Limited" or "Pvt. Ltd." for a private limited company.

Registered Office Clause: It specifies the location where the company's registered office is situated. This office is where all official communications and notices are sent.
Objective Clause: This clause delineates the main objectives for which the company is formed. It's important to define these objectives clearly, as the company cannot undertake activities beyond those mentioned in this clause.

Liability Clause: It outlines the extent of liability of the company's members. In the case of companies limited by shares, the liability of members is limited to the amount unpaid on their shares. For companies limited by guarantee, members' liability is limited to the amount they undertake to contribute if the company is wound up.

Capital Clause: This clause specifies the authorized capital of the company, i.e., the maximum amount of share capital the company is authorized to issue. It also mentions the division of this capital into shares and their respective nominal value.
Association Clause: It simply states that the subscribers wish to form a company and agree to become members of it, in accordance with the terms of the MOA.
Importance of Memorandum of Association:
Legal Requirement: The MOA is a legal requirement for the formation of a company. It must be filed with the Registrar of Companies during the incorporation process.
Constitutional Document: It serves as the company's constitutional document, defining its scope, powers, and limitations.
Protection of Members: It protects the interests of the company's members by clearly defining the objectives and limiting their liability.
External Communication: It provides clarity to external parties, such as investors, creditors, and regulatory authorities, regarding the company's objectives and powers.

Binding Authority: The company and its members are bound by the provisions of the MOA. Any action taken beyond its scope may be considered ultra vires (beyond the powers) of the company and therefore void.

8. What is the Guerrero Gold Belt?
• The Guerrero Gold Belt (GGB) is becoming a world class district for
gold mineral exploration with over 21 million ounces discovered in
the last two decades within a 40 km trend.
• Geological characteristics of an emerging mining district
– BIG: Not one off deposits but multiple deposits that are unified by
common geological characteristics
– SYSTEMATIC: Processes that formed the deposits are part of the
same geological system
• If Big and Systematic, then you have a reasonable predictability and
higher probability of discovery
